In our area (Southeast US), many McDonalds restaurants have self-order kiosks... the only interaction you have with a human being is when they deliver your food. They're used for inside dining, not drive through.
At the Kiosk, you pick the food you want, customizing your order as needed, and pay with your credit or debit card. You take one of the numbered pylons (lower left in the picture) , enter it on the kiosk when prompted, and place it on your table. Your food is delivered to you a few minutes later. Note that you can still order from a cashier but sometimes it takes a few minutes for a cashier to appear because they are busy filling and delivering food orders.
